what are the factors of x^2-8x-20

Respuesta :

miraculouslbcomics
miraculouslbcomics miraculouslbcomics
  • 03-12-2020

Answer:

(x+2)(x−10)

Step-by-step explanation:

x^2-8x-20

Factoring means  something like  this:

(x+_)(x+_)

Add together to get -8

Multiply together to get -20

think of the two numbers

Try 2 and -10:

2+-10 = -8

2*-10 = -20

Fill in the blanks of  with 2 and -10 to get

(x+_)(x+_) = (x+2)(x−10)
